The National Monuments Service's description

A short rectangular cist was discovered in 1929 in a sandpit in 'Carrowntober' townland. It contained the unburnt bones of a child and a fragmentary bipartite vase (Waddell 1990, 92; Cahill and Sikora 2011). Not precisely located but it may have been found in the area where another cist (GA084-045----) was found in 1931 - see GA084-045----.
